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pontlottyn to Heworth start from as little as £35.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pontlottyn to Heworth start from £218.00 one way, or £219.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pontlottyn to Heworth are available for £234.70 one way, or £469.30 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ities at Pontlottyn Station

Pontlottyn Train Station is modestly equipped, reflecting its role as a smaller stop. Currently, there is no ticket office or ticket machines available on-site. To purchase or collect tickets, you would need to plan ahead by buying your ticket online. Thankfully, smartcards are supported with validators available at the station. This makes the check-in process much simpler for frequent travelers.

Passengers seeking assistance or information can rely on helplines and regular announcements, despite the station not being staffed. There's a noted emphasis on accessibility with step-free access available throughout the station, providing convenient entry from Picton Street. For further details or to request assistance with your journey, visiting the National Rail’s Passenger Assist page is recommended.

Amenities for Travelers

When it comes to amenities, Pontlottyn offers limited options. There's no provision for refreshments, shops, or ATMs, so it’s advisable to handle such needs before arriving at the station. The absence of waiting rooms and restrooms requires passengers to manage their time efficiently, ensuring they arrive just in time for their departures. Luggage storage facilities are unavailable, so consider traveling light or arranging secure storage beforehand.

Parking is available, operated by Transport for Wales, and is conveniently open 24-hours. With only ten spaces, it’s vital to arrive early to secure a spot. Fortunately, parking is offered free of charge, which is a definite perk for regular commuters to and from Pontlottyn.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Complementing the rail services, Pontlottyn has close ties with bus routes, with bus stops located on Merchant Street and Waterloo Terrace. The station also features a clearly marked rail replacement bus stop at its entrance, ensuring smooth transitions during service disruptions. Station Facilities and Accessibility

Despite its unassuming nature, Heworth Station provides some basic amenities. There is no manned ticket office, but passengers can easily buy and collect pre-purchased tickets using the available ticket machines, which are fully accessible. The station is categorized as a Category B Station, meaning that while it is unstaffed, it has ramped access to platforms, ensuring w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ments can navigate without issues. However, do note that facilities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ment services, and bicycle storage are lacking, perhaps making it more of a transit point than a hangout location.

Though CCTV is not present, there are customer help points scattered throughout the station to ensure assistance is just a call away, offering a sense of security and support to travelers. For those seeking additional help, the conductor on the arriving train is available to assist with boarding and disembarking needs. More details about this service can be found at the Passenger Assist page.

Onward Travel and Transport Links from Heworth

Heworth station seamlessly integrates with multiple transport options, making it a pivotal access point for further travel. The nearby Tyne and Wear Metro station means that reaching local destinations is convenient. Should you need a taxi, the service can be arranged via platforms like Cab4You, helping to ensure stress-free onward journeys. However, bus services are less accessible immediately around the station, so some forward planning is advisable. For any queries, travelers can connect with Busline at 0871 200 2233.
